স্ট্রিম সাইফারের প্রয়োগ

স্ট্রিম সাইফার (Stream Cipher) - ক্রিপ্টোগ্রাফি (Cryptography) - Computer Science

259


স্ট্রিম সাইফার তার দ্রুতগতির এবং রিয়েল-টাইম প্রসেসিং ক্ষমতার কারণে বিভিন্ন ক্ষেত্রে প্রয়োগ করা হয়। স্ট্রিম সাইফারের মূল প্রয়োগ ক্ষেত্রগুলো নিচে তুলে ধরা হলো:

১. ওয়্যারলেস যোগাযোগ

ওয়্যারলেস যোগাযোগে স্ট্রিম সাইফার ব্যাপকভাবে ব্যবহৃত হয় কারণ এটি ডেটা এনক্রিপ্ট করতে খুব দ্রুত। উদাহরণস্বরূপ, Wi-Fi সিকিউরিটি প্রোটোকল (WEP) প্রাথমিকভাবে RC4 স্ট্রিম সাইফার ব্যবহার করত, যদিও এখন এটি কিছু নিরাপত্তা ত্রুটির কারণে পরিত্যাগ করা হয়েছে। তদ্ব্যতীত, বিভিন্ন মোবাইল নেটওয়ার্ক এবং ব্লুটুথেও স্ট্রিম সাইফার ব্যবহার করা হয়, যেখানে দ্রুতগতির এনক্রিপশন প্রয়োজন হয়।

২. রিয়েল-টাইম ভিডিও এবং অডিও স্ট্রিমিং

স্ট্রিম সাইফার বাস্তব-সময়ের ভিডিও ও অডিও স্ট্রিমিং ডেটা এনক্রিপশনের জন্য বিশেষভাবে উপযোগী, কারণ এটি বিট-বাই-বিট বা বাইট-বাই-বাইট এনক্রিপশন করতে সক্ষম। ফলে প্রতিটি ফ্রেম বা ডেটা সেগমেন্ট দ্রুত এনক্রিপ্ট হয়, যা ভিডিও ও অডিও ট্রান্সমিশনের গতি বজায় রাখতে সহায়ক। বিভিন্ন স্ট্রিমিং প্ল্যাটফর্ম এবং অনলাইন কমিউনিকেশন টুলে স্ট্রিম সাইফার ব্যবহৃত হয়।

৩. টেলিকমিউনিকেশন প্রোটোকল

টেলিকমিউনিকেশনে যেখানে কম-ব্যান্ডউইথে ডেটা ট্রান্সমিশন হয়, সেখানে স্ট্রিম সাইফার প্রায়ই ব্যবহৃত হয়। বিভিন্ন টেলিকমিউনিকেশন প্রোটোকল যেমন GSM (Global System for Mobile Communications) স্ট্রিম সাইফার ব্যবহার করে। GSM এর A5/1 এবং A5/2 এনক্রিপশন অ্যালগরিদম স্ট্রিম সাইফারের ভিত্তিতে কাজ করে যা ডেটা সুরক্ষিত রাখে।

৪. VPN এবং নিরাপদ টানেলিং

VPN (Virtual Private Network) সংযোগে স্ট্রিম সাইফার ব্যবহার করা হয়, বিশেষত যেখানে রিয়েল-টাইম ডেটা এনক্রিপশন প্রয়োজন। স্ট্রিম সাইফারের দ্রুত ডেটা প্রসেসিং ক্ষমতা VPN-এর মাধ্যমে ডেটা ট্রান্সমিশনকে সুরক্ষিত রাখে। উদাহরণস্বরূপ, Salsa20 এবং ChaCha20 হলো স্ট্রিম সাইফার যা কিছু VPN প্রোটোকলে ব্যবহৃত হয়।

৫. আইওটি (IoT) ডিভাইস

Internet of Things (IoT) ডিভাইসগুলোতে স্ট্রিম সাইফার ব্যবহৃত হয় কারণ এটি কম পাওয়ার এবং কম মেমরি ব্যবহার করে দ্রুত এনক্রিপশন করতে সক্ষম। IoT ডিভাইসে নিরাপত্তা খুব গুরুত্বপূর্ণ এবং স্ট্রিম সাইফারের হালকা ও দ্রুতগতি এই ডিভাইসগুলোতে সুরক্ষা নিশ্চিত করতে সহায়ক।

৬. মেসেজিং অ্যাপ্লিকেশন

অনলাইন মেসেজিং অ্যাপ্লিকেশন যেমন WhatsApp, Signal ইত্যাদি স্ট্রিম সাইফার ব্যবহার করে ডেটা এনক্রিপ্ট করে, কারণ এতে রিয়েল-টাইম ডেটা সুরক্ষা নিশ্চিত করা যায়। এটি মেসেজ ট্রান্সমিশন এবং রিসিভের সময় ডেটাকে নিরাপদ রাখে এবং বার্তা দ্রুত ট্রান্সমিট করতে সক্ষম করে।

৭. ফাইল এনক্রিপশন ও ডিস্ক এনক্রিপশন

কিছু স্ট্রিম সাইফার বড় ফাইল বা ডেটাব্লক এনক্রিপশনেও ব্যবহৃত হয়, যেখানে এনক্রিপশনের সময় ডেটা দ্রুত প্রসেস করতে হবে। স্ট্রিম সাইফারের মাধ্যমে ডেটার বিট-বাই-বিট এনক্রিপশন করা যায়, যা ডিস্ক এনক্রিপশনের জন্যও উপযোগী।

সারসংক্ষেপ

স্ট্রিম সাইফার তার দ্রুতগতির প্রসেসিং এবং কমপ্লেক্সিটি কম থাকার কারণে রিয়েল-টাইম ডেটা এনক্রিপশন প্রয়োজন এমন প্রায় সকল ক্ষেত্রেই ব্যবহৃত হয়। দ্রুতগতির সুরক্ষিত যোগাযোগ নিশ্চিত করতে স্ট্রিম সাইফারের ব্যবহার আধুনিক প্রযুক্তিতে একটি অপরিহার্য উপাদান।

Promotion

Are you sure to start over?

Loading...